A Maryland cop who placed a gun against the head of a man because he had stepped out of an illegally parked car was convicted today. And only because the incident was captured on video. Prince George’s County police officer Jenchesky Santiago was found guilty of first-degree assault, second-degree assault, misconduct in office and the use of a firearm in the commission of a crime of violence.
